Data Science is best played as a team sport. Zeppelin facilitates this collaboration via a web based notebook interface to state-of-the-art big data (Flink, Spark, Hive, Cassandra, and many more), with custom visualization powered by AngularJS built in. Markdown allows for rich notation in-line with the code. Work can be shared seamlessly across the organization. Further, interactive visualizations can be shared with business analysts and sales reps, great for prototyping and proof of concepts. But the collaboration also runs between technologies, by leveraging the Zeppelin Context sharing variables BETWEEN contexts. E.g. the results of a Flink paragraph can be passed to a Spark paragraph; the best tool can be used for the job can be used at each step in analytics pipeline and a data scientist who loves Scala Flink can easily work with a data scientist who loves pyspark.
